    Chr. Hansen has opened its new facilities in Argentina. The new premises will be the cornerstone in the company's aim to expand its activities in the Argentine food market. In addition to modern offices and conference rooms, the new 2,000 square meter facilities comprise pilot plants and application labs for Meat & Prepared Foods, Food & Beverages, and Dairy."We have been active in Argentina for more than 40 years," says Jan Boeg Hansen, Group Vice President for Chr. Hansen. "After some years with a slow-down in the Argentine economy, it is again showing promise, and we believe that the time is ripe to strengthen our activities in the country."

    Umpqua Dairy Products of Oregon has chosen CSB-SYstem to provide an ERP (Enterprise Resource Planning) system. The new system will be implemented in phases, starting with inventory management, sales, purchasing, and quality management. The second phase involves production planning, monitoring, and control. Soon after, a network of handheld devices will be employed by Umpqua's 50 sales-drivers to streamline distribution and customer replenishment. Established in 1931, the family-owned dairy firm is the largest independent dairy in southern Oregon.

    Following the recent acquisition of utowrappers, Europack and GEI Ashford, a new Bradman Lake company is being formed. Bradman Lake Group Limited will own the assets and manage the combined operations of the three former GEI businesses and current Bradman Lake companies in Bristol, UK, Charlotte, N.C., and Wiggensbach, Germany.

    Markem Corp. has been named an authorized RFID specialist by Zebra Technologies. As an authorized RFID specialist, Markem is fully qualified to sell, install, and service Zebra's line of industry-leading RFID printers/encoders. As part of this program, Markem will receive priority access to Zebra RFID training and forums, technical support, and other incentives targeted towards increasing its market share and revenue.

    Videojet Technologies Inc., Wood Dale, Ill., has announced an agreement with the Hewlett-Packard Co. to develop new variable printing solutions for the graphics market using HP thermal ink jet technology. Videojet, a Danaher company, will work with HP Specialty Printing Systems to provide these solutions. Lettershops, commercial printers, service bureaus and in-house plants that need to print addresses, barcodes, graphics and customized messages will be able to leverage the capabilities of this technology and provide an increased spectrum of services for their customers.

    AdvantaPure, Southampton, Pa., is touting a new International Distribution Network, offering customers in North and South America, Europe, Asia, and Australia quick access to the company's sanitary tubing, hose, fittings, and assemblies products. The network allows nearly worldwide coverage for markets such as pharmaceutical, biomedical, food, beverage, dairy, cosmetic, chemical, and others involving high purity applications. AdvantaPure distributors included in the Network are found in the United States and Puerto Rico, Canada, Brazil, Belgium, Sweden, Finland, Japan, Korea, and Malaysia.
